"Hitherto have ye asked nothing in my name: ask, and ye shall receive, that your joy may be full."--John 16:24About the Author: Charles H. Spurgeon became so popular that his published Sunday sermons were literally sold by the ton. He continually appealed to his audiences to allow the Lord to minister to them individually. Highlighted with splashes of spontaneous, delightful humor, his teachings still provide direction to all who are seeking true joy and genuine intimacy with God.*******Prayer brings big answers [headline]Prayer is the Christian's lifeline to God, and with it lives are changed for eternity! Charles Spurgeon knew the secrets of prayer and that God has established divine principles and promises for our every need. He reveals these principles and shares how God has answered the prayers of men and women since the beginning of Bible times. He also shows how you can...* Gain freedom over sin* Enjoy peace in troubled times* Protect yourself from Satan* Offer short prayers that bring big answers* Receive bountiful blessings* See God answer even faulty prayers* Get what you pray forBecause God keeps His promises, every Christian can have a prayer life that produces lasting results both personally and in the kingdom of God. Discover how you, too, can develop essential characteristics required for power-packed prayer!
